
OnePlus 10R key specifications leaked, could come with 150W fast charging
India Today
The key specifications of the upcoming OnePlus 10R smartphone have surfaced online, which suggests the device will be similar to the recently launched Realme GT Neo 3 in terms of features.
OnePlus is said to launch 6 smartphones this year and one of them will be unveiled in India on March 31. In the coming months, the company is also expected to announce the OnePlus 10R, which will be a successor to the OnePlus 9R. Now, the key specifications of the upcoming OnePlus smartphone have surfaced online, which suggests the device will be similar to the recently launched Realme GT Neo 3 in terms of features.
91Mobiles in collaboration with tipster Yogesh Brar claims that the OnePlus 10R will pack a bigger 120Hz display and battery with faster-charging support than the OnePlus 9R. The device is said to sport a 6.7-inch AMOLED E4 display with HDR 10+ certification, similar to the OnePlus 10 Pro. But, this one will have a flat panel, which will run at Full HD+ resolution. The front and back will reportedly be covered by Corning Gorilla Glass. It will likely have stereo speakers, but it is expected to ditch the 3.5mm headphone jack.
OnePlus will reportedly provide 150W fast charging, which will be one of the key USPs (User Selling Point) of the device. It is being said that the company will launch two models of OnePlus 10R. One of them will have a 5,000mAh battery with support for 80W charging and the other one will feature a 4,500mAh battery with 150W tech. This is something that Realme has done with the new GT Neo 3 handset too.

A report from PriceBaba claims that the OnePlus 10R could miss out on the Alert Slider that users get with premium OnePlus phones. If this turns out to be true, then this will be the first numbered OnePlus device to ditch this feature.
If the OnePlus 10R launches with the same specs, then the purchase decision for consumers will come down to software and design. The Realme GT Neo 3 is currently only available in China and it is currently unknown as to when it will arrive in India. The device has made an appearance on the BIS certification site and it is expected to make its debut in India in April or May, as suggested by tipster Abhishek Yadav.
